我正在使用EPSON epos iOS SDK构建cordova打印插件,以便将其与混合移动应用程序(基于离子框架)一起使用。 sdk提供了打印文本和图像的方法。但我必须使用它打印HTML模板。有没有办法这样做?
就好像我可以从模板准备UIWebView对象并将其转换为UIImage。我是iOS开发的新手,所以不知道这样做的正确方法。
答案 0 :(得分:0)
您可以在屏幕外渲染#maincontent2
,然后将其捕获为UIWebView
。以下答案可能会帮助您解决问题。您可能遇到的一个问题是UIImage
除非您在UIWebView
上添加,否则不会加载,此窗口可以是任何UIWindow
对象,不一定是您向用户显示的窗口。
How to get ENTIRE image from UIWebView including offscreen content
Does iPhone/iPad UIWebView need to be active view to render?